U.K. turns CCTV, terrorism laws on pooping dogs
Dünya # 12.05.2008 00:33:28

The United Kingdom has the most surveillance cameras per capita in the world. With the recent news that CCTV cameras do not actually deter crime, how can the local town councils justify the massive surveillance program? By going after pooping dogs.

Appeals court issues split ruling in Alcatel-Lucent patent case
Dünya # 12.05.2008 00:33:28

A federal appeals court issued a split ruling on Alcatel-Lucent's patent infringement lawsuit against Microsoft and Dell.

Facebook crowd blamed for trashing English garden
Dünya # 12.05.2008 00:33:28

A water fight announcement posted on social-networking site Facebook is being blamed for damaging an award-winning public garden in England.

Microsoft to appeal EC's $1.39 billion fine
Dünya # 12.05.2008 00:33:28

Microsoft announced Friday it's appealing the $1.39 billion fine the European Commission imposed for failure to comply with its historic 2004 antitrust order against the Redmond giant.

Wind power company Noble files for public offering
Dünya # 12.05.2008 00:33:28

Wind energy company Noble Environmental Power has filed to raise as much as $375 million in an initial public offering, according to a document with the Securities and Exchange Commission that was filed Thursday.
